692891-81-9,15822-71-6,681459-29-0,845781-95-5,654072-85-2,661484-84-0 Supplier | KPCKS.IN
CMO CDMO service. KPCKS.IN supply 692891-81-9,15822-71-6,681459-29-0,845781-95-5,654072-85-2,661484-84-0 and related compounds.
681459-29-0 692891-81-9 654072-85-2 15822-71-6 845781-95-5 661484-84-0